Sentence Puzzles are a fun and engaging way for primary students, especially ELL kids, to order words into a complete sentence on their independent reading level in a fun and engaging way. Use these levelized puzzles for a warm up in guided reading, literacy stations or centers, and as a carousel activity for group work in grades K-2!
